  • Patent number: 4891492
    Abstract: A tool support mechanism for a robot is adapted for carrying a tool, such as a welding torch. A series of shafts, pulleys and belts cooperate such that upon rotary input, a first arm rotates about a first end thereof with respect to a frame, a second arm rotatably connected at a first end thereof to a second end of the first arm translates but does not rotate with respect to the frame, and a tool support rotatably connected to a second end of the second arm translates but does not rotate with respect to the first arm. The mechanism thus allows a tool to be rotated about an axis spaced from the axis of rotary input.

  • Patent number: 4175693
    Abstract: A method for enhancing the reliability of output data from a label reader adapted to read a bar code consisting of a plurality of bars. Each bar in the bar code is scanned at a plurality of points and sets of binary symbols representative of the scanned points along each bar are obtained. Two sums are then formed for each bar, the first being the number of binary "1"s in the set and the second being the number of binary "0"s in the set, and the ratio of two sums is computed. If the ratio is larger than (1+.alpha.) for .alpha.>0, then the data corresponding to the numerator sum is regarded as reliable. If the ratio is less than (1-.beta.) for 0<.beta.<1, then the data corresponding to the denominator sum is regarded as reliable. If the ratio is equal to or larger than (1-.beta.) but equal to or less than (1+.alpha.), then the data is regarded as unreliable.

  • Patent number: 4160901
    Abstract: A coincidence testing method for enhancing the reliability of output data from a label reader adapted to read a bar code consisting of a plurality of bars. Each bar in the bar code is scanned at a plurality of points and sets of binary symbols representative of the scanned points along each bar are obtained. Then the binary symbols in each set are ordered to correspond to the order of the scanned points or segments along each bar. Then coincidence tests are performed on successive pairs of binary symbols in each set to determine whether a reliable decision can be made for each bar.

  • Patent number: 4158435
    Abstract: A method and apparatus for reading label bar codes in which a photoelectric signal representative of an optically scanned bar code label is differentiated. The positive and negative peaks of the differentiated signal are detected, and the time intervals between the peaks are measured by counter means to produce output signals representative of the bar code label. A multi-level threshold comparison technique is used to detect and predict the occurrence of positive and negative peaks.
